Isaiah 43:2 “When thou passest through the waters, I will be with thee; and through the rivers, they shall not overflow thee: when thou walkest through the fire, thou shalt not be burned; neither shall the flame kindle upon thee.” In the fragile silence, just before the morn writes her gentle story across the believer’s life there is a quiet reminder that no heart can scorn, adoring the Healer of all our grief and strife remembering the whispers of a life who is sure arising from the ashes, all the shadows are gone grace who brings assurance – we have the cure for all the dark’s dilemmas, lifted by spirit’s dawn In the stillness, where cool light reflects the soul abides a trembling moment, before we would know what it means to love with love that makes us whole, beyond the spirit’s yearning, in the ebb and flow… while my heart rests in the palm of His strong hand, my story continues on in scripts of light, flowing erasing the darkness, who wars despite what He planned the music playing, restoring me – Yes, I’m growing! In the Christmas tree shimmering with dreams in my eyes, stories written, rewritten, by a pen greater than my own reminders that His love, His truth, His grace never dies and when all is said and done, when all the seeds are sown I remember the victory of the One who hung on that tree, all those years ago, before my time was written into the song with rhythms of light, softly playing, soothing as I fall to my knee… with praises meant for the Son, to whom I’ve clung all along! While I can’t truly tell if what stirs in my soul is a dance, written by love that found its way through the pain to the light, the moment that offers me a second chance as the stars cry and the winds subside with the rain revelations of His love, sent to the hearts who believe He is the way, the truth, the life – the ever flowing light Who came to see us through, even though we grieve His love assures us that there is hope for making things right.
